“Adults are considered protected if they have had doctor diagnosed measles or 2 doses of a measles vaccine given after 12 months of age. Measles immunisation has been given at different ages since it was introduced in NZ in 1969.” [source Regional Public Health]. “Measles is a highly contagious disease that can be life threatening.
